Enhanced meningeal lymphatic drainage ameliorates neuroinflammation and hepatic encephalopathy in cirrhotic rats

2020-05-03

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background and aims</h4> Hepatic encephalopathy (HE) is a serious neurological complication in patients with liver cirrhosis. Nothing is known about the role of the meningeal lymphatic system in HE. We tested our hypothesis that enhancement of meningeal lymphatic drainage could decrease neuroinflammation and ameliorate HE. <h4>Methods</h4> A 4-week bile duct ligation (BDL) model was used to develop cirrhosis...
